About Mazingira Day

Mazingira Day is an official public holiday observed in Kenya. Like many national holidays, it provides residents with a day off from work and school, allowing time for rest, reflection, and celebration.

The observance of Mazingira Day reflects the cultural, historical, or religious traditions that are important to the people of Kenya. Public holidays play a vital role in national identity, giving communities shared moments to come together.
